ClinConnect Summary
The INSPIRE-Lung Study is a research trial aimed at finding new ways to encourage people at high risk of lung cancer to get screened for the disease. The study uses innovative methods, like targeted ads on Facebook, to reach individuals who have a history of smoking and may not be aware of the importance of lung cancer screening. The ultimate goal is to help more people get screened early, which can lead to better outcomes if lung cancer is detected.
To participate in this study, individuals need to be between 18 and 90 years old and have a significant smoking history, such as smoking for many years or having quit within the last 15 years. However, people who have already been screened for lung cancer, have a current lung nodule being monitored, or have ever been diagnosed with lung cancer are not eligible. Participants can expect to engage in discussions about lung cancer screening and make decisions regarding their health with support from the study team. The study is currently recruiting participants, so if you meet the criteria, you may have the opportunity to contribute to important research in lung cancer prevention.

Eligibility criteria
- Inclusion Criteria:
- • ≥20-pack-year smoking history;
- • Individuals who currently smoke or quit smoking within the past 15 years
- Exclusion Criteria:
- • Previously undergone LDCT for early detection of lung cancer, have a lung nodule or nodules that are currently being followed
- • Has ever been diagnosed with lung cancer
- • Individuals with impaired decision-making (because our primary outcome is decision-making, we will not include individuals with impaired decision-making)
